[VOTE] Release ActiveMQ-CPP v3.3.0

Hi Everyone

Voting for the release of v3.3.0 of ActiveMQ-CPP is now open.  This is a
major release of the ActiveMQ-CPP client which includes some API changes
and several new features and improvements. Some additional methods have
been added to the CMS API to make it easier to use, see the API
documentation for more information. 

Some highlights for this release:

* Solved some deadlock issues that could occur during failover 
  when using asynchronous consumers.
* Synchronous Consumers now get an exception if they call receive
  when the Connection has failed.
* CMS API now provides an XA domain for linking the CMS client 
  into XA transactions.
* The Failover Transport now supports the connection rebalancing 
  feature in ActiveMQ.
* Fixes in the Stomp handling allow the client to work with 
  ActiveMQ Apollo.
* Better message redelivery processing for Transacted consumers.
* Fixes to the AutoConf script make builds more reliable.
